diff --git a/apps/maarch_entreprise/log.php b/apps/maarch_entreprise/log.php
index 00145689834ce30f3eb8a4ef022bb8f01d73904b..01b5fba5afb88cce36412be2077692623f669843 100755
--- a/apps/maarch_entreprise/log.php
+++ b/apps/maarch_entreprise/log.php
@@ -168,7 +168,7 @@ if (!empty($_SESSION['error'])) {
                 $ad = new LDAP($domain, $login_admin, $pass, $ssl);
             }
         } catch (Exception $conFailure) {
-            if (!empty($standardConnect)) {
+            if (!empty($standardConnect) && $standardConnect == 'true') {
                 $res = $sec->login($login, $password);
                 $_SESSION['user'] = $res['user'];
                 if (empty($res['error'])) {
diff --git a/modules/ldap/xml/config.xml.default b/modules/ldap/xml/config.xml.default
index a595f0ee5a285e11bc8ede6de0a41d39fbed0a46..0f200e65ac7b9d50d543541e615b9f9eb5243986 100755
--- a/modules/ldap/xml/config.xml.default
+++ b/modules/ldap/xml/config.xml.default
@@ -23,6 +23,7 @@
         <lost_users>false</lost_users>
         <!-- Si LDAP est desactive alors le pass de chaque utilisateur est son login -->
         <pass_is_login>true</pass_is_login>
+        <standardConnect>false</standardConnect>
     </config>
     
    <!-- Est utile uniquement pour la synchroniqation des donnees -->